Infrastructure Capital and 60 Degrees Pharmaceuticals Interviews to Air on the RedChip Small Stocks, Big Money(TM) Show on Bloomberg TV
ORLANDO, FL / ACCESS Newswire / April 2, 2026 / RedChip Companies will air interviews with Infrastructure Capital Advisors, LLC (NYSE:SCAP)(NYSE:PFFA)(NYSE:BNDS) and 60 Degrees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(NASDAQ:SXTP) on the RedChip Small Stocks, Big Money™ show, a sponsored program on Bloomberg TV this Saturday, April 4, at 7 p.m. Eastern Time (ET). Bloomberg TV is available in an estimated 73 million homes across the U.S.

Jay Hatfield, Founder, CEO, and Portfolio Manager of Infrastructure Capital, appears on the RedChip Small Stocks Big Money™ show on Bloomberg TV to discuss his investment philosophy and approach to small-cap markets. He highlights the firm's emphasis on independent financial modeling and fundamental analysis, particularly in underfollowed small-cap companies, where internally developed financial projections can uncover market pricing inefficiencies. Hatfield also outlines the importance of focusing on profitable businesses, disciplined valuation frameworks such as PEG-based analysis, and avoiding overvalued or unproven companies to mitigate downside risk. Drawing on experience across investment banking, portfolio management, and corporate advisory, he provides perspective on evaluating corporate decision-making, identifying red flags, and navigating market cycles. He also shares views on the macro environment, noting inflation trends and interest rate expectations as key drivers influencing small-cap performance and broader equity market conditions.
Geoffrey Dow, PhD, CEO of 60 Degrees Pharmaceuticals, appears on the RedChip Small Stocks Big Money™ show on Bloomberg TV to discuss the Company's mission to combat vector-borne diseases with innovative, small-molecule therapeutics. Dr. Dow will highlight the potential of ARAKODA® (tafenoquine), an FDA-approved antimalarial developed with the U.S. Army, and its expanding commercial footprint in the U.S. He will also outline the company's plan to expand FDA approval for tafenoquine to babesiosis-a growing tick-borne illness, incidence of which management believes is vastly underrepresented by CDC estimates and for which there is no FDA-approved therapy. 60 Degrees Pharmaceuticals has three clinical trials (hospitalized babesiosis patients and relapsing patients and chronic babesiosis) underway. 60 Degrees Pharmaceuticals has Orphan Drug status for tafenoquine for babesiosis and patent exclusivity for the malaria indication through 2035.

About Infrastructure Capital Advisors
Infrastructure Capital Advisors, LLC (ICA) is an SEC-registered investment advisor that manages exchange traded funds (ETFs) and a series of hedge funds. The firm was formed in 2012 and is based in New York City. ICA seeks total-return opportunities driven by catalysts, largely in key infrastructure sectors. These sectors include energy, real estate, transportation, industrials and utilities. It often identifies opportunities in entities that are not taxed at the entity level, such as master limited partnerships ("MLPs") and real estate investment trusts ("REITs"). It also looks for opportunities in credit and related securities, such as preferred stocks.
Current income is a primary objective in most, but not all, of ICA's investing activities. Consequently, the focus is generally on companies that generate and distribute substantial streams of free cash flow. This approach is based on the belief that tangible assets that produce free cash flow have intrinsic values that are unlikely to deteriorate over time. About 60 Degrees Pharmaceuticals, Inc.
60 Degrees Pharmaceuticals, Inc., founded in 2010, specializes in developing and commercializing new medicines for the treatment and prevention of vector-borne disease. The Company achieved U.S. Food and Drug Administration approval of Its lead product, ARAKODA® (tafenoquine), for malaria prevention, in 2018. ARAKODA is commercially available in the U.S. and Australia. 60 Degrees Pharmaceuticals, Inc. also collaborates with prominent research and academic organizations in the U.S. and Australia. 60 Degrees Pharmaceuticals, Inc. is headquartered in Washington, D.C., with a subsidiary in Australia.
